Are you passionate about helping people make the most of their career? Helping companies improve hiring? Are you a digital AdTech native, with programmatic ad optimization in your DNA? DHI’s mission is to build the best niche career marketplaces, including Dice.com, eFinancialCareers.com, and ClearanceJobs.com, connecting qualified tech professionals to employers who seek them.

We’re looking for an energetic product leader with experience delivering large, strategic ad tech/performance marketing products. You’ll guide several teams across the business to transform how our customers engage and attract the best talent using pay-for-performance ad technologies, from concept through go-to-market delivery. You will craft a strategic and differentiated product that maximizes our marketplace yield, drives better value and results for our customers, and delivers a more engaging experience for job seekers using our career platforms.

Understanding our vision, strategy and solution dynamics, you’ll focus delivery teams on what’s most important. As an extraordinary communicator, you’ll work in Agile fashion with technology, product marketing, sales, finance, customer service and other product peers to translate the product concepts into reality.

You’ll test and learn to reduce risk along the way, while tracking the overall achievements that need to come together for a successful launch. Once launched, you’ll continue to lead us to iterate and improve the product to reach its full potential and market share, boosting the value and experience we deliver, growing into more channels, and increasing efficiency.

Required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:

You’ll need deep expertise in the ad technology industry, optimally from experience with performance marketing, algorithmic optimization of paid search (pay-per-click, pay-per-action, pay-for-performance), campaign/bid management, programmatic ad platforms, auction, yield optimization and ad distribution networks. You’re well grounded in web technologies, search, user experience design, big data/data science algorithms, and reporting. SEO, SEM experience are also useful.
